The TDA8705AT is a video analog-to-digital converter (ADC) manufactured by Philips Semiconductors (PHI).
The TDA8705AT is designed for high-speed video signal digitization, commonly used in TV and video processing applications. It integrates a sample-and-hold circuit, an 8-bit flash ADC, and an output buffer.
This ADC is optimized for video signal processing, ensuring accurate digitization for applications such as video capture and display systems.
*(Note: Philips Semiconductors is now part of NXP Semiconductors, but the original manufacturer marking may still appear as PHI.)*
